Renal Technician

Job Description

Under the direction of a Registered Nurse (RN), the Renal Technician provides care in an outpatient setting to patients with End Stage Renal Disease. The role involves performing patient care and selected procedures that comply with all established standards and practices, as well as performing other related duties as needed, within the framework, training, and education provided.

Responsibilities

  • Provide patient care according to approved hospital policies and procedures.
  • Initiate and discontinue hemodialysis treatments with various access types.
  • Monitor patients during dialysis treatments, chart observations, observe patients for complications, and communicate appropriate information to nursing staff.
  • Perform routine disinfection and cleaning of hemodialysis equipment and satisfactorily maintain related records.
  • Administer dialysis medications according to established hospital procedures.
  • Access, input, and retrieve information from the information system.
  • Effectively operate and troubleshoot the water system, solution delivery, and the hemodialysis machine during treatments.
  • Prepare bicarbonate solution for distribution through the distribution system.

Essential Skills

  • Experience with dialysis and hemodialysis procedures.
  • Competency in operating crit-line and other dialysis-related technologies.
  • Certified Clinical Hemodialysis Technician (CCHT) certification or ability to obtain within 18 months of hire.
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) and/or CPR certification from the American Heart Association or American Red Cross, or ability to obtain within 90 days of hire.

Additional Skills & Qualifications

  • High School Diploma or equivalent required.
  • Associate Degree in Renal Technology or equivalent training and/or experience preferred.
